Building and General Maintenance Technician jobs in Florence, South Carolina involve repairing and maintaining buildings and equipment. Responsibilities include performing inspections, troubleshooting issues, and completing repairs. These technicians must have strong technical skills and be able to work independently. Building and General Maintenance Technicians in Florence, South Carolina are essential in ensuring that buildings and facilities are properly maintained and functioning. - Entry-level Maintenance Technician salaries range from $30,000 to $40,000 per year - Mid-career Building Maintenance Technician salaries range from $40,000 to $50,000 per year - Senior-level General Maintenance Technician salaries range from $50,000 to $60,000 per year The role of Building and General Maintenance Technicians in Florence, South Carolina has a long history of being integral to the upkeep of various structures in the area. Over time, the role has evolved to include not only traditional maintenance tasks but also the integration of new technologies and sustainable practices to ensure the longevity and efficiency of buildings. Current trends in the field of Building and General Maintenance in Florence, South Carolina include a focus on energy efficiency, green building practices, and the use of predictive maintenance technologies to prevent costly breakdowns and repairs.
